residential purposes which would not change the existing impact to the <br />neighborhood. <br />Based on the foregoing, the Applicants' application for a Variance is granted with the following <br />conditions: <br />1) The applicant shall provide a written acknowledgement and consent from the property <br />owner to the south regarding the construction of the drain field at a zero setback from <br />their property line. <br />2) The proposed septic design shall incorporate a second tank in accordance with the review <br />comments from rete Ganzel of Washington County dated February 3, 2012. The final <br />design shall be reviewed and approved by the City Engineer prior to construction of any <br />portion the treatment system. <br />3) The applicant shall plant a replacement tree on the premises to account for the large oak <br />tree that will be removed due to the installation of the treatment system. The type of tree <br />and replacement location shall be reviewed and approved by the Planning Director. <br />4) The applicant shall comply with all conditions of approval as specified by the City <br />Engineer in his review memorandum dated February 7, 2011 <br />S) The applicant shall review measures to be undertaken to avoid potential problems from <br />flooding with the City Engineer prior to installation of the septic tanks. <br />6) The applicant shall sign a legal short form that will be recorded against the property <br />documenting the conditions of approval that are attached to the variance. <br />Passed and duly adopted this 8th day of February 2012 by the City Council of the City of Lake <br />Elmo, Minnesota. <br />Brett Emmons, sting Mayor <br />T; <br />BeA.
